GNC Names Carmine Fortino as Executive Vice President, Business Development

Brings strong multi-channel experience in the natural products industry.

PITTSBURGH - July 29, 2013 // PRNewswire // - GNC Holdings, Inc. (NYSE: GNC),the nation's largest specialty retailer of health, wellness and sports nutrition products, today announced that it has named Carmine Fortino as Executive Vice President, Business Development. Mr. Fortino comes to GNC with extensive experience in the natural products industry and was also a former Director of General Nutrition, Centers, Inc. from 2007-2011.Joseph Fortunato, GNC's Chairman, President & Chief Executive Officer, said, "Carmine is a great addition to the GNC senior management team. His background in multi-channel development across the health & wellness segment will enhance our approach to new market opportunities as we continue to implement GNC's proven growth strategy."

Mr. Fortino is a seasoned executive with extensive high-level experience leading multi-brand, multi-channel environments augmented by a solid background in supply chain logistics.

Most recently, Mr. Fortino was President of North American operations for Atrium Innovations, Inc., a Canadian natural health products company. In that role, his focus was on directing and building strong brand positions within the Health Food Store, Health Care Professional and Direct to Consumer channels. He is also a former CEO of Seroyal International, Inc., a Toronto-based natural nutraceutical company.

Prior to that, Mr. Fortino held various management roles within Loblaw Companies Limited, including Executive Vice President of Ontario operations. Earlier, he served as Executive Vice President of Zehrmart Limited, an Ontario-based grocery chain owned by Loblaw Companies Limited.

About GNC Holdings, Inc.

GNC Holdings, Inc., headquartered in Pittsburgh, PA, is a leading global specialty retailer of health and wellness products, including vitamins, minerals, and herbal supplement products, sports nutrition products and diet products, and trades on the New York Stock Exchange under the symbol "GNC."

As of June 30, 2013, GNC has more than 8,300 locations, of which more than 6,200 retail locations are in the United States (including 969 franchise and 2,189 Rite Aid franchise store-within-a-store locations) and franchise operations in 55 countries (including distribution centers where retail sales are made). The Company – which is dedicated to helping consumers Live Well – has a diversified, multi-channel business model and derives revenue from product sales through company-owned retail stores, domestic and international franchise activities, third party contract manufacturing, e-commerce and corporate partnerships. GNC's broad and deep product mix, which is focused on high-margin, premium, value-added nutritional products, is sold under GNC proprietary brands, including Mega Men®, Ultra Mega®, Total Lean™, Pro Performance®, Pro Performance® AMP, Beyond Raw®, and under nationally recognized third party brands.
